Description:

Nova Cas 21 has brightened dramatically since its discovery on 18 March of this year and can now be seen with the naked eye from a dark sky site. I captured this image of Nova Cas 21 and its surroundings early Tuesday morning. Nova Cas 21 is currently at least as bright as HIP115395, which is a 5.55 magnitude star.
